Music on Main
The Downtown Bozeman Association is proud to present the Ninth Annual Music on Main summer concert series this summer in Historic Downtown Bozeman. Music on Main will be located on Main Street from Rouse Avenue to Black Ave. The fun will last from 6:30 PM till 8:30 PM on Thursday evenings from July 2nd to August 20th.

Bring the kids from 6:30 PM to 7:30 PM for planned activities with Kenyon Noble’s Junior Carpenter program, First Security Bank, Children’s Museum and more on the west side of Bozeman Avenue on Main Street. Grab a bite to eat from one of food vendors that will right along the south side of Main Street, stop by some of our local non-profit booths for information about their great organizations or step into a few of the Downtown stores that stay open late!

The music begins at 7:00 PM and lasts until 8:30. A big thanks to our Major Sponsors; The Rocking R Bar, Kenyon Noble, 95.1 “The Moose”, The Pour House and Bronken’s Distributing.

The Downtown Bozeman Partnership, along with the City of Bozeman and the Bozeman Police Department would also like to inform the public of the rules and regulations regarding the Open Container Waiver for the Music on Main summer concert series.

The Open Container Waiver allows for anyone over the age of 21 to have an open container of alcohol in the event area including Main Street from Black to Rouse Avenues during the Music on Main event on Thursday nights from July 2nd to August 20th. Anyone with an open container outside of these perimeters before 6pm or after 9pm will be subject to a $100 open container ticket issued by the City of Bozeman.

We will be providing additional information about the Open Container regulations on cups used at the event, around MSU campus, within bar establishments and around the community for your review. The event is FREE and open to the public, but please leave your dogs and coolers at home and NO glass or cans are allowed in the event are. In case of rain all festivities will be cancelled.
